Alarm triggers response at Popeye's Chicken on Rivers AveNorth Charleston SC

audio iconBurglary
Near Rivers Ave, North Charleston, SC 29406

Fire and police responded to an alarm activation at Popeye's Chicken near Rivers Avenue. No smoke, fire, or confirmed threats were found. An individual dressed in costume was identified as part of an event nearby.
